About Lyle Bettger

Lyle Stathem Bettger was an American character actor who had roles in Hollywood films and television from the 1950s onward, often portraying villains. One such role was the wrathfully jealous elephant handler Klaus from the Oscar-winning film The Greatest Show on Earth (1952). Bettger's theatrical debut was in Brother Rat at the Biltmore Theatre in New York City in 1936.
